Where Outdated People Systems Begin to Show...
Policies No Longer Reflect How Work Happens
Your workforce, locations, roles, or service model have changed, but employees are still working within expectations and processes created for an earlier version of the business.
HR Operates in Reaction Mode
Immediate requests, documentation, compliance needs, and employee issues leave little capacity to examine how the organization’s people practices work together.
Similar Situations Produce Different Decisions
Attendance, performance, conduct, flexibility, and employee concerns are handled differently depending on the manager, department, or location.
Accountability is Hard to Enforce Consistently
Roles, decision authority, performance expectations, and escalation paths are not clear enough to support reliable follow-through across the organization.
Leadership Keeps Revisiting the Same People Problems
The names and circumstances may change, but recurring workforce issues continue consuming leadership time because the underlying system has not been addressed.
Exployees Experience Gaps in the Employee Lifecycle
Hiring, onboarding, feedback, development, recognition, and issue resolution do not operate as a connected experience, weakening trust and retention over time.
These aren't isolated HR issues but signs that your organization’s people infrastructure needs to be realigned with the business as it operates today.
